By 2017, violent crime had dropped more than 60% from 1990 levels and murders had fallen from 42 in 1992 to 1 in 2017, a decrease of more than 97%. Over the past 25 years, East Palo Alto has evolved from having the highest per capita homicide rate in 1992 to one homicide in 2017. EAST PALO ALTO They were toddlers when their town earned the dubious distinction of Americas murder capital a quarter-century ago. In this bayside community bypassed by Silicon Valleys wealth, gunfire became the soundtrack to childhoods spent avoiding parks and hustling home before dark. In 1986, statistics showed there were 922 crimes per 10,000 people; in 2008, that ratio had dropped to 355 crimes per 10,000 residents.
